About The Position

Satair is looking for a Summer Intern - Operations to join our Operations team based in Dulles, VA. In this role you’ll get exposure to multiple areas of our site Operations team spanning across Warehouse Operations, Customer Resolution Services, Planning, Supply Management and other areas. The regional operation team ensures execution on the day to day business to provide support to our customers. We bridge strategy and execution to ensure reliable, cost-effective aerospace solutions. The Washington, D.C. metro area is home to multiple Airbus offices: In our nation’s capital you will find the Airbus Experience Center, a collection of interactive, multimedia exhibitions highlighting the extensive role the company plays in the aviation, aerospace and defense industries in the U.S. and around the world. The D.C. area is also home to our regional corporate headquarters – located adjacent to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D) - it makes flying in a breeze! Participation in the Summer 2027 Intern Program: May 17th - August 6th 2027. Involvement in various governance meetings that encompasses the entire operational organization of Satair. You will touch various projects and reporting tools throughout the internship to add value to the overall operational team. Dedicated support to your development throughout the program.

Responsibilities

  • Support the business operational initiatives by collecting, analyzing, and synthesizing key operational data into actionable reports and presentations to inform management decisions.
  • Work closely with the regional operational leadership team to understand daily operations and understand where support can be provided.
  • Assist in identifying opportunities for efficiency improvements.
  • Assists in various projects and supports the project leaders as needed.
